#
# Copyright 2006-2007 Openedhand Ltd.
#
ROOTFS_PKGMANAGE = "dpkg apt"
do_rootfs[depends] += "dpkg-native:do_populate_sysroot apt-native:do_populate_sysroot"
do_populate_sdk[depends] += "dpkg-native:do_populate_sysroot apt-native:do_populate_sysroot bzip2-native:do_populate_sysroot"
do_rootfs[recrdeptask] += "do_package_write_deb"
do_rootfs[vardeps] += "PACKAGE_FEED_URIS"
do_rootfs[lockfiles] += "${DEPLOY_DIR_DEB}/deb.lock"
do_populate_sdk[lockfiles] += "${DEPLOY_DIR_DEB}/deb.lock"
python rootfs_deb_bad_recommendations() {
if d.getVar("BAD_RECOMMENDATIONS"):
bb.warn("Debian package install does not support BAD_RECOMMENDATIONS")
}
do_rootfs[prefuncs] += "rootfs_deb_bad_recommendations"
DEB_POSTPROCESS_COMMANDS = ""
opkglibdir = "${localstatedir}/lib/opkg"
python () {
# Map TARGET_ARCH to Debian's ideas about architectures
darch = d.getVar('SDK_ARCH')
if darch in ["x86", "i486", "i586", "i686", "pentium"]:
d.setVar('DEB_SDK_ARCH', 'i386')
elif darch == "x86_64":
d.setVar('DEB_SDK_ARCH', 'amd64')
elif darch == "arm":
d.setVar('DEB_SDK_ARCH', 'armel')
}
# This will of course only work after rootfs_deb_do_rootfs or populate_sdk_deb has been called
DPKG_QUERY_COMMAND = "${STAGING_BINDIR_NATIVE}/dpkg-query --admindir=$INSTALL_ROOTFS_DEB/var/lib/dpkg"
